Output 34540eebdec438752eae3df7c11d54d701e7a42439efd5ba72d55431ebd55f7f:0

value
190066
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8f17a42b7481d22a589d98ecb1d756ab754508d OP_EQUAL
address
3MU7A8pGo6UZmmcFAJi1LzcVXNgx9vgqwY
transaction
34540eebdec438752eae3df7c11d54d701e7a42439efd5ba72d55431ebd55f7f
confirmations
195113
spent
true